General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.651(c)(2): A stairway, ladder, ramp or other safe means of egress was not located in trench excavations that were 4 feet (1.22m) or more in depth so as to require no more than 25 feet (7.62m) of lateral travel for employees. On or about March 17, 2015 and at times prior to employees were exposed to struck by and engulfment hazards when not provided a safe means of egress from trench excavation during gas line pressure testing being conducted by the employer.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.651(d): Employees exposed to public vehicular traffic were not provided with a warning vest or other suitable garments marked with or made of reflectorized or high-visibility material: On or about March 17, 2015 and at times prior to employees were exposed to struck by hazards when not provided reflectorized or high visibility garments when working from trench excavation located next to public roadway during gas line pressure testing conducted by the employer.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.652(a): 29 CFR 1926.652(a)(1): Each employee in an excavation was not protected from cave-ins by an adequate protective system designed in accordance wit paragraph (b) or (c) of this section: On or about March 17, 2015 and at times prior to employees who worked in trench excavation were exposed to crush by and engulfment hazards during gas line pressure testing conducted by the employer in the failure to install protective systems to prevent excavation cave in on trench greater than 5 feet in depth.
